Error: 404 Not Found

Sorry, the requested URL 'http://bestlife.pro/create-christmas-postcards-free/free-greeting-card-template-cards-templates-create-for-sending-to-download-christmas-postcards-templa/' caused an error:

Not found: '/create-christmas-postcards-free/free-greeting-card-template-cards-templates-create-for-sending-to-download-christmas-postcards-templa/'